Park Jin (Yu Jun Sang) learned that Jang Wook had been secretly trying to meet Mudeok and handed him a book called the Book of Hearts, telling him that he could only go out if he could read the book. However, the book was impossible to read as it was blank to the eyes of an ordinary man and could not be read by someone who was not well trained. Watching him struggle, Master Lee (Im Chul Soo) helped him by telling him that the book was a love letter to a blind woman and that he needed to think of the word the love letter starts with. In the meantime, Mudeok was among the participants of the SongrimŌĆÖs Servant Contest. The crown prince (Shin Seung Ho), Seo Yul (Hwang Min Hyun) and Park Dang Gu (Yoo In Soo) teamed up to steal the contest paper and solve all the questions correctly for Mudeok to win the first round. At the end of the episode, Jang Wook made viewersŌĆÖ hearts pound as he got upfront about his feelings for Mudeok by replying to what he thought was her love letter to him. He pulled out a SongrimŌĆÖs servant recruitment poster that she had thrown him and said, ŌĆ£It is all written here. I will go out of my way to see you. I can do anything at all costs to see you.ŌĆØ He then showed his feelings for her, replying, ŌĆ£And this is my reply. I also missed you.ŌĆØ In response to his sincere heart, Mudeok thought, ŌĆ£I should have braced myself before letting him get this close to me. What I gave him should not have been read or delivered in the first place. It was my foolish and pathetic love letter,ŌĆØ and revealed her feelings for him. The episode ended with a shocking cliffhanger as a mysterious woman named So Yi (Seo Hye Won), who knows about MudeokŌĆÖs past, got kidnapped by Jin Mu (Jo Jae Yoon). Source (1)
